How to Install Sanas Accent Translator MSI through CLI

This article provides step-by-step instructions for installing the Sanas Accent Translator MSI file through the Command Line Interface (CLI) in Admin mode.


Open CLI/Command Prompt in Admin Mode:

To begin the installation process, open the Command Line Interface (CLI) in Administrator mode to ensure proper permissions.


Locate Sanas MSI File

Navigate to the directory where the Sanas MSI file is located. This step is essential for the CLI to locate and execute the installation package.

Execute Command 

Execute the following command to install the Sanas Accent Translator MSI file with the provided license key. 

Note: An INVALID license key is used for sample purposes.
msiexec /i SanasaccentTranslator-V1-1.24.0206.14-ind-prod.msi LICENSEKEY="INVALID_LICENSE_KEY" /q

The above command installs the App in silent mode. License will be applied to all the user profiles in the machine.


License Check

After the installation is complete, open the Sanas application and check if the license has been successfully applied.


Note: Ensure that the Command Line Interface is opened with administrative privileges to avoid any permission-related issues during the installation.
